Also note that of course fastest to/fro airport is the national train, NMBS/SNCB, but any exit/entry at the airportstation also requires an extra airport Diabolo-surcharge of over 5€/time=much more as a normal single would cost. There are several local buses too-without this. Or perhaps the place you stay is closer by another local smaller station.
IF only using MIVB easiest and even cheapest is just check IN with bankcard (yes, british will also work), it is 2,30 per ride (incl normal changes), but topped at 8,40 per calender day, taken in the night after.
MIVB runs the metro, trams and citybuses, including a few routes fanning out of the city. If more is wanted or also other means/operators: check their site.
There are reductions for seniors >65, but these require additional administration and a personal MoBiB chipcard, so not really worth it for just 1 day.
